- [ ] **Key ceremony, step 7 — verify reconnect fix before signing.** Confirm the Tellwick client's websocket reconnect patch is merged: the old code dropped session keys on reconnect, which would invalidate signatures minted during the ceremony. Reviewer should check that backoff caps at 30s and the key handle survives socket churn. Once verified, the ceremony HSM partition may be opened using the passphrase below.

vault phrase of yawig-bawig = fenael-norael-eliox-gilox-casath-druath-zorys-istwyn-jorwyn

Finance Review Summary — Training Budget, Next Fiscal Year

Prepared for the heads of department. The proposed training allocation rises eight percent, driven mainly by the Larkspur certification program and expanded onboarding at the Dunmere site. Travel-linked training is trimmed in favor of facilitated remote cohorts. Department caps remain unchanged pending the December review. Please weigh your requests against the strategic direction noted confidentially below.

confidential, tagep-yahag: Headcount on the Oliael team goes from 5 to 100 by the end of July. Gross margin on Oliael came in at 20 percent against a plan of 15 percent.

## Runbook: Publishing ProseCheck Releases

Before approving the release PR, confirm the version bump in the manifest matches the changelog heading and that the lint rule catalog regenerated cleanly. Tag the commit only after CI passes on the release branch. The publish job signs the tarball automatically; your task as reviewer is to verify the detached signature against the fingerprint recorded in the security register. If fingerprints differ, halt and escalate. For reference during review, the active release signing key is included below.

signing key of bagap-yawep = bky13_TbfT6ZMUoGJo2

Data stores — Paritywick rate checker. The crawler writes raw rate snapshots from partner sites into the snapshots store; the comparison engine reads those, computes parity violations per property, and persists results to the findings schema. Retention is 90 days for snapshots, indefinite for findings. Maintainers should note that schema migrations must run against the findings store first. Both schemas live in one cluster, reachable via the connection string below.

primary connection of yagep-kahip = redis://giliel_svc:zYiKsLL2PLpfPL@db-348f.xolmarsys.corp:5432/fenwyn